Finishing includes mounting, diecutting, coating, laminating, embossing punching,
gluing, and marbleizing. Binding is the work required to convert printed sheets
into books, magazines, catalogs, and folders.
All finishing processes require special planning before the job is even printed.
In addition to the processes listed, printed pieces may be diecut, coated or laminated.
Many laminates and coatings will react with certain inks and discolor them. Be sure
you and your printer are fully aware of the printing requirements that are affected
by the finishing processes.
